Retained HR services involve outsourcing some or all of a company’s human resources functions to a third-party provider These services can include recruiting and hiring, employee training and development, performance management, and compliance with labor laws and regulations By retaining HR services, companies can focus on their core business activities while leaving the administrative tasks to professionals.
Similarly, retained health and safety (H&S) services involve outsourcing the management of health and safety requirements to a specialist provider These services can include conducting risk assessments, developing safety policies and procedures, providing safety training, and ensuring compliance with health and safety regulations By outsourcing H&S services, companies can minimize the risk of accidents and injuries in the workplace and protect the well-being of their employees.
